Instructions to make Braided cardamon bread:
  1. Prepare and weigh all your ingredients.
  2. In a bowl,add milk +yeast + honey and let it gloom for 5 minutes,this is to ensure that the yeast is active.
  3. After 5 minutes, in the same bowl add cardamon powder+ oil +salt, and mix everything together.
  4. Start adding flour bit by bit as your mix everything together.
  5. Knead until it is a dough, in case of stickiness,add flour and knead till it is soft.
  6. Apply oil to the basin, place the dough in the basin and cover it with a damp cloth and let it proof for 1hr,by placing it in a warm place.
  7. After 1hr, the dough will have doubled in size
  8. Knock it back, and divide the dough into 3 equal portions
  9. Take one part,and roll into a rope,do this to the two parts of the dough and align them together.
  10. Here, you can start braiding it, (like how we do it with our hair) and place it in a baking tray that is already greased.
  11. Cover it again and let it proof again in a warm place for 30-40 mins, once double in size,egg wash it with and egg or milk and sprinkle some seeds
  12. Bake for 30 mins, at temp of 180degres in a pre -heated oven.
  13. After cooling, enjoy a slice of it with a cup of milk or your favourite tea or coffee

It's served as coffee table treat with coffee or tea, and typically all around the year. In Finland pulla is typical in cafeterias where it is considered as a sign of quality of the place.
